#' Calculates adjacency matrix from similarity matrix
#'
#' @param data similarity matrix
#' @param method adjacency function ("sigmoid", "power", "none")
#' @param alpha alpha parameter for sigmoid function
#' @param theta theta parameter for sigmoid function
#' @param beta beta parameter for power function
#'
#' @return
#' @export
#'
#'
adjacency <- function(data, method, alpha, theta, beta) {
#
if (!method %in% c("sigmoid", "power", "none"))
stop("Adjacency function not known. Use sigmoid, power or none.")
# Set diagonal to 0
data[col(data) == row(data)] <- 0
# Sigmoid function
if (method == "sigmoid" && hasArg(alpha) && hasArg(theta)) {
data <- 1 / (1 + exp(- alpha * (data - theta)))
# Power function
} else if(method == "power") {
data <- data ^ beta
# could not be computed
} else if(method == "none") {
data <- data
} else {
stop("Wrong AF name or parameter missing.")
}
#
return(data)
}
